Admission: The curriculum at Osmania University is pretty strict, but it's all good. The student to teacher ratio is like 10:1, so you can get help easily. They even have extra teachers for tough subjects. The courses are not too hard, and anyone can pass the exams. Most of the teaching is through lectures with projectors and stuff. Every semester, we have exams and practicals at the hospital.
Placement: They helped 100% of us find jobs in Hyderabad after we graduated. Salaries ranged from Rs. 10,000 to Rs. 20,000 based on skills. Seniors got Rs. 8,000 to Rs. 17,000 monthly. Only a few of us did internships. Jobs were in marketing, hospital quality, operations, HR, department heads, and junior exec roles. Everyone got internships. Those already working just stayed on and even got promoted later.
Campus: Our college is part of Deccan Pharmacy College. The classrooms are on the 1st floor, while the library, computer room, and staff rooms are on the 5th floor. The hostels are at MBBS campus Santhosh Nagar, Owaisi hospital campus. The hostels are nice, and the food is okay.

Admission: The teachers in this course are awesome! They're super helpful and really know their stuff. The way they teach is top-notch. The course material is spot on and gets us ready for the industry.
Placement: A lot of us landed jobs in hospitals after graduation. The pay was around Rs. 20,000-25,000 monthly, which is pretty good. Some of us got roles like hospital admin, while others became managers. Most of us, like 75-80%, found jobs or internships. The course really teaches you a lot about working in a hospital.
Campus: The classrooms have AC, and students can use Wi-Fi, computer lab, and library. We get to do postings in hospitals and go on hospital visits. It's cool to see how different hospitals work government, primary, secondary, and tertiary ones. Love getting hands-on experience!
